Tweaking DLSS for Better Quality

DLSS (Deep Learning Super Sampling) is an advanced rendering technique that leverages artificial intelligence to upscale lower-resolution images in real-time. By enabling DLSS and selecting the appropriate quality settings, you can significantly enhance image sharpness and overall visual quality. Setting LOD Bias for DirectX Games

LOD (Level of Detail) bias is a setting that determines how detailed objects appear at different distances in a game. By adjusting the LOD bias for DirectX games, such as Microsoft Flight Simulator, you can strike a balance between performance and visual fidelity.
